JMcN Sieburth is a scholar working on Ecology, Oceanography and Environmental Chemistry.
According to data from OpenAlex, JMcN Sieburth has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 328 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Ecology, 5 papers in Oceanography and 4 papers in Environmental Chemistry. Recurrent topics in JMcN Sieburth’s work include Microbial Community Ecology and Physiology (7 papers), Marine and coastal ecosystems (5 papers) and Methane Hydrates and Related Phenomena (4 papers). JMcN Sieburth is often cited by papers focused on Microbial Community Ecology and Physiology (7 papers), Marine and coastal ecosystems (5 papers) and Methane Hydrates and Related Phenomena (4 papers). JMcN Sieburth collaborates with scholars based in United States. JMcN Sieburth's co-authors include Einar Hjörleifsson, Everly Conway de Macario, Michael E. Sieracki, DA Caron and PL Donaghay and has published in prestigious journals such as Marine Ecology Progress Series.
